- Dreyer, speaking on The Parent Chat episode released Thursday, said she keeps her job and parenting in separate mental spaces that both feel whole.
- She likened the split to the series Severance on Apple TV+, describing how she switches off work thoughts at home and mom thoughts at work.
- Revisiting an old Today clip, she recalled early fears about losing her identity when pregnant with her first child and said new parents do not have to become a different person.
- She told listeners it is healthy to enjoy time away from kids and said she values solo time as much as time with her three boys.
- The Today host shares sons Calvin, Oliver, and Russell with estranged husband Brian Fichera, and outlets note she announced a separation in July 2025 and reportedly filed for divorce in March.
